Blend and winemaking
This Grand Cru is made from Pinot Noir grown on a limestone-clay terroir with natural drainage, the mineral signature of the Côte de Nuits. The harvest, carefully sorted, preserves the integrity of the grapes to express the finesse of the fruit and the depth of the site. Winemaking favours precision, aiming for a restrained extraction that serves texture and balance. The ageing lasts approximately 16 to 20 months in oak barrels, with about 30% new, for a subtle integration of wood without ostentation. This patient maturation polishes the tannins, refines the framework and enhances the wine's verticality. The result combines aromatic purity, a silky mouthfeel and savoury length, hinting at a cellaring potential worthy of the finest bottles.
Tasting notes
- Appearance: Deep ruby, clear and glossy, edged with garnet reflections, betraying the concentration of the vintage and the nobility of the terroir.
- Nose: Initial aromas of raspberry and wild cherry, lifted by an airy floral touch. These are followed by notes of underwood, a hint of truffle, a recall of candied fruit and discreet oak suggesting cocoa bean and gentle spices.
- Palate: Soft and precise attack, broad mid-palate with a fine tannin grain. The balance marries density and freshness, the finish lingering long on a delicate salinity and a high-class aromatic persistence.
Serving temperature and advice
Serve between 16 and 18°C in a large Burgundy glass to reveal the full complexity of the bouquet and the silkiness of the texture. A decanter of about 1 hour is recommended in the early years to soften the structure and to open up developing tertiary aromas. Store bottles on their side, away from light, with stable humidity and temperature. This Grand Cru has a strong cellaring potential, which will gradually reveal the most noble aspects of the terroir and the patina of the ageing.
